I can't seem to get custom portraits to show up in Grimrock 2
Have the file format changed or is the feature disabled atm?
I've tried using 128x128 .tga in 16, 24 and 32 bit placed in the 'Users\[username]\Documents\Almost Human\Legend of Grimrock 2\Portraits' folder
the portraits works fine in Legend of Grimrock 1.
The default background image from LoG 1 does not show up in LoG2 either.
** EDIT ** SOLVED
Ok I found out how to make it work, the file names needs to have the correct naming convention, [race]_[gender]_[01.. etc].tga
ex. human_female_01.tga
there is a subfolder in the LoG2 install directory with the portraits from LoG1, using their naming convention makes custom portraits show up in LoG2
